About

Remsoft develops advanced planning and optimization analytics software, enhancing operational efficiency in the forestry and asset-intensive sectors through innovative solutions and data-driven insights. Founded in 1992 in Fredericton, Canada, Remsoft specializes in providing software solutions for optimizing forestry and asset management processes. Remsoft specializes in delivering advanced planning and optimization analytics software, focusing on solutions that enhance efficiency and decision-making within the forestry and asset-intensive industries. Its flagship offerings include Remsoft Operations, a cloud-based platform that centralizes data and operational plans, and Woodstock Optimization Studio, which employs prescriptive analytics and optimization modeling to address complex scheduling and supply chain challenges. These products are designed to optimize lifecycle forest management, carbon management, and infrastructure asset management, providing users with actionable insights to improve productivity and performance.


The client base consists of companies in sectors such as forestry, pulp and paper, mining, automotive, oil and gas, and transportation, operating across various geographical markets, including North America, South America, and Asia Pacific. Remsoft generates revenue through a subscription-based model, offering clients access to its software solutions and services. Transactions typically involve clients purchasing licenses for Remsoft's products, alongside potential consulting services to tailor the solutions to their specific needs. The company structures its offerings to cater primarily to B2B clients, enabling organizations to integrate advanced analytics into their planning processes.


Pricing plans vary based on the specific software chosen and the scale of implementation, with options available for both individual products and comprehensive solutions, thus facilitating a range of financial commitments based on the size and requirements of the client's operations. In March 2025, Banneker Partners invested in Remsoft, allowing the company to create a unified forestry intelligence platform aimed at streamlining planning and operations. This investment supports the development of upcoming products designed to enhance operational capabilities within target markets, including North America and Asia Pacific. Remsoft aims to leverage this funding to expand its geographical reach and enhance its product offerings, with a focus on launching new solutions by the end of 2026.
